Re: Water lily, and the final of the set.

Of all of the flower photosgraphs you have posted lately, I think this is the best of the lot.
Why?
This is most colorful and the repeating shapes and sizes of the pedals is good.
I think that your placement of the flower just off center was a good choice.
The only thing that bothers me is the light and lines at the bottom. It's not that distracing, but my eye wanders there. Watching your background will help with that next time.

Re: Water lily, and the final of the set.

Good lighting and I agree the bullseye framing here works fine as the starlike form of the flower can be dealt with that way. i like the deep saturation in the middle and fading colors towards the petals. Yes, the bright area towards the bottom of the frame could use to be burned in to darken and lessen its demand for attention. Good image and congrats on the sticky!
